The Manitoba Métis Federation (MMF) is the National Government of the Red River Métis - also known as the Manitoba Métis. The Red River Métis are Canada’s Negotiating Partners in Confederation and the Founders of the Province of Manitoba.
The MMF seeks to fill one full-time Research Coordinator position within our Rights Research Department located at 150 Henry Ave in Winnipeg, MB. The Research Coordinator is responsible for facilitating productive meetings, ensuring research projects and agreement deadlines are met, driving progression on critical files and fostering and maintaining relationships.
